内容提要
Amazon RDS和Aurora是AWS中的两种数据库解决方案,简化管理并提升可扩展性。RDS支持多种数据库引擎,适合多种应用;Aurora则提供更高性能,特别适合云规模应用。两者各有优势,适用于不同开发需求。
关键要点
-
Amazon RDS和Aurora是AWS中的两种数据库解决方案,简化管理并提升可扩展性。
-
RDS支持多种数据库引擎,适合多种应用,提供成本效益和可扩展性。
-
Aurora是高性能数据库引擎,兼容MySQL和PostgreSQL,适合云规模应用。
-
RDS的主要优势在于管理任务的自动化,允许开发者专注于应用功能。
-
RDS提供自动备份、高可用性、多AZ部署和读副本等关键特性。
-
Aurora提供比传统MySQL高达5倍的性能,且支持更高的读副本数量。
-
选择RDS适合需要多种数据库引擎和较少变更的应用,选择Aurora适合高性能和低延迟需求。
-
RDS适合成本敏感的应用和开发测试环境,Aurora适合高可用性和可扩展性要求的企业应用。
-
迁移到Aurora或RDS可能面临数据一致性、停机管理和应用兼容性等挑战。
-
Amazon RDS和Aurora为全栈开发提供可靠、高性能和可扩展的数据库解决方案。
延伸问答
Amazon RDS和Aurora的主要区别是什么?
Amazon RDS支持多种数据库引擎,适合多种应用,而Aurora提供更高性能,特别适合云规模应用。
选择Amazon RDS的最佳场景是什么?
选择RDS适合需要多种数据库引擎和较少变更的应用,或是成本敏感的开发测试环境。
Amazon Aurora的性能优势有哪些?
Aurora提供比传统MySQL高达5倍的性能,且支持更多的读副本,适合高性能需求的应用。
使用Amazon RDS时有哪些关键特性?
RDS提供自动备份、高可用性、多AZ部署和读副本等关键特性,简化数据库管理。
迁移到Aurora可能面临哪些挑战?
迁移到Aurora可能面临数据一致性、停机管理和应用兼容性等挑战。
Amazon RDS适合哪些类型的应用?
RDS适合成本敏感的应用、开发测试环境以及需要多种数据库引擎的应用。